What the college says

In A Level Computer Science, you will develop the skills necessary to design and implement effective computer solutions. This comprehensive course covers programming in various languages such as C#, SQL and Haskell, allowing you to become proficient in multiple programming languages. The creativity of the practical work is supported by theory so you gain a thorough understanding of the underlying principles. We develop this theoretical background so that you will have a deeper understanding of many aspects including, for example, algorithmic efficiency, internet security and object orientated programming.

What you need to get on

3 GCSE passes at a minimum of Grade 4 and 2 at Grade 5, which must include English Language or Literature and Maths at Grade 4.
